Nevzat Aydın Invests in Science-Backed Cosmetics Brand "ya da Multicosmetics"

Tech investor Nevzat Aydın has invested in "ya da Multicosmetics," a Turkish cosmetics brand founded by Toxicologist Pharmacist Tuba Çalık. Operated by an all-women team, the brand aims to accelerate R&D efforts, support international growth, and expand into 1,000 pharmacies across Turkey by the end of July.

The global beauty and personal care market is projected to reach approximately $636 billion by 2026 and $817 billion by 2031, while the Turkish cosmetics market reached $3.85 billion in 2025. According to Euromonitor data, beauty and personal care sales in Turkey grew by 39% during the same period, with the skincare category reaching $1.74 billion. With the global clean beauty market expected to surpass $20 billion by 2030 and the science-backed skincare segment projected to exceed $200 billion, investor interest in science-backed cosmetics continues to rise.

Driven by these market dynamics, entrepreneur and investor Nevzat Aydın invested in ya da Multicosmetics, a 100% Turkish cosmetics brand founded by Toxicologist Pharmacist Tuba Çalık. Operating with a science-backed formulation approach and an all-women team, the company offers products across skincare, sun protection, sensitive skincare, baby/child care, and oral care. By placing human biology, toxicology, and ingredient safety at the core of its product development, the brand plans to use the investment to strengthen its R&D infrastructure and take its formulations to international markets.
